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Cunningham Park (west) (Queens, NY)
Cunningham Park is strategically situated in the heart of Queens, offering a significant green lung for the surrounding neighborhoods of Fresh Meadows, Oakland Gardens, and Hollis Hills. The park is bordered by Francis Lewis Boulevard to the west and Union Hall Street to the east, with 73rd Avenue and 75th Avenue forming its northern and southern boundaries, respectively. Major roadways like the Grand Central Parkway and the Clearview Expressway are easily accessible, providing direct routes into Manhattan, Brooklyn, and other parts of Long Island. Parking within and around the park can be challenging, especially during peak event times, so understanding the local traffic patterns and planning your arrival is crucial. Public transportation options include various bus lines that service the park's perimeter, connecting to subway lines for broader city access. Rideshare services are also a viable option, though surge pricing can be a factor during large events.

Alley Pond Park
Alley Pond Park is one of Queens' largest public parks, offering a diverse range of natural habitats and recreational facilities. Visitors can explore wetlands, forests, and meadows, with walking and biking trails winding through the landscape. The park features an adventure course, playgrounds, and sports fields, making it a versatile destination for outdoor enthusiasts of all ages. It’s a great spot for a change of scenery from Cunningham Park, offering a more nature-focused experience with opportunities for birdwatching and picnicking. The park's nature center provides educational programs and insights into the local ecosystem.
Northern Blvd & Springfield Blvd · 1.5 miQueens County Farm Museum
Step back in time at the Queens County Farm Museum, the largest available tract of open space in New York City. This historic working farm offers a unique glimpse into agricultural life, with farm animals, heritage gardens, and vintage farm equipment on display. It’s a family-friendly destination with seasonal events, hayrides, and a farm stand selling fresh produce. The museum provides a relaxing and educational experience, a welcome contrast to the athletic intensity of Cunningham Park. It's an ideal spot for a leisurely afternoon exploring rural charm within the urban landscape.

Union Turnpike · 3.7 miLocal Tips & Year-Round Info
- Francis Lewis Boulevard can experience significant local traffic, particularly during school drop-off/pick-up times and weekend sporting events.
- Parking within Cunningham Park is often first-come, first-served, and can fill up quickly for popular amateur tournaments.
- On warm weekends, expect the park to be busy with families, sports leagues, and community groups utilizing the open spaces.
- Public transportation access relies heavily on bus routes that connect to subway lines, so check schedules in advance.
- Bring your own seating and shade, as permanent benches and covered areas can be limited across the park's expanse.
